Script Korit 11 is a regular weight, normal width, very high contrast, italic, short x-height font.

A flowing, right-leaning script with very strong thick–thin modulation and sharp, pointed terminals. Capitals are tall and decorative, built from looping entry strokes and extended swashes, while lowercase forms are compact with a short x-height and narrow counters. The rhythm alternates between delicate hairlines and bold downstrokes, giving words a sparkling, high-contrast texture. Numerals follow the same calligraphic logic, with curved forms and small finishing flicks that echo the letter terminals.

Best suited for high-impact display settings such as wedding stationery, formal invitations, luxury branding marks, certificates, and short editorial headlines. It performs most confidently at larger sizes where the hairline strokes and interior details remain clear, and where ornate capitals have room to breathe.

The overall tone is polished and ceremonial, evoking traditional penmanship and engraved invitations. Its dramatic contrast and sweeping capitals read as luxurious and romantic rather than casual or everyday.

The design appears intended to mimic formal calligraphy with an emphasis on dramatic contrast, graceful motion, and showy capitals. It prioritizes elegance and flourish over utilitarian readability, aiming to create a premium, commemorative feel in short phrases and titling.

Letterforms show a consistent slanted stress and a strong baseline flow, but connections vary—some characters appear more joined while others separate—so the texture can shift between continuous script and spaced calligraphy depending on the letter pairings. The capitals are especially prominent and can dominate a line, creating a strong hierarchy between initials and the rest of the word.
